Hardscape Landsc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Hardscape landscaping services involve designing and installing durable, functional features that enhance outdoor spaces using materials such as stone, concrete, brick, and pavers.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, driveways, fire pits, and outdoor stairs. Property owners often seek these services to improve the usability and aesthetic appeal of their yards, creating spaces suitable for entertaining, relaxing, or navigating their property more easily. Before requesting hardscape work, homeowners should consider factors like the intended purpose of the feature, the style and materials that complement their property, and any necessary permits or structural requirements.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ners interested in hardscape services. It’s helpful to think about the overall design, budget, and how the new features will integrate with existing landscaping. Clarifying preferences for materials, colors, and layout can ensure the final result aligns with the desired look and functionality. Additionally, property owners should be aware of any site-specific considerations, such as drainage, soil conditions, and space constraints, which can influence the planning and execution of hardscape projects.

Hardscape Landscaping Questions
What types of projects are included in hardscape landscaping? Hardscape landscaping covers features like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or living spaces that enhance the property's structure and function.
How can hardscape features improve property value? Well-designed hardscape elements add aesthetic appeal and functionality, making outdoor areas more attractive and usable for gatherings and activities.
What materials are commonly used in hardscape landscaping? Common materials include concrete, stone, brick, pavers, and natural rock, chosen for durability and visual appeal.
Are hardscape features suitable for different yard sizes? Yes, hardscape elements can be customized to fit various yard sizes and layouts, from small gardens to expansive outdoor spaces.
